Happy New Year

Happy New Year

Many hopes still unfulfilled
Despite how strongly they were willed
But when reflecting on what's been
Recall the details of each scene

Like Sherlock, you may find what's real
The things which matter in each deal
For passing quickly are our lives
And onward our intention drives

So what is possible from this place?
Choose wisely, all are in the race
And wishes may not be enough
Prepare them well, life can be tough

Dream on, then, and with equal measure
To sacrifice and things of pleasure
The resolutions must be kept
Or once again those tears are wept

So positive thinking, will of steel
Move with thought, and don't just feel
Another chance to break through fear
To all, my friends, a Happy New Year!

(c) Simon J. Halliday 2013
